WebIf you have a freezer compartment in a fridge with a separate freezer door, you can store frozen milk for three to four months. If your freezer door is contained within your refrigerator space, you can only keep frozen milk for up to two weeks. When you use a separate deep freezer, you can store expressed breast milk for six months or longer.
